#f216df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f216df is composed of 94.9% red, 8.6%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 305.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#f216df color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#e500bf.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#f216df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f216df has RGB values of R:242, G:22,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.08,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15865567.

Shades and Tints of #f216df

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090008 is the darkest color, while #fef5fe is the lightest one.
